| Jack Kitching was a schoolteacher in Bradford, following his retirement from Northern he moved up to Cumbria, where he was involved in coaching, Whitehaven I believe, and I also informed he dabbled in politics. Served in the Royal Navy during the war as an officer, and was torpedoed, spending four hours in the Irish sea before being rescued. Them was assigned to convoy duties in the med guarding convoys to Malta, hardly a safe posting.
